While Xen is a specific open-source hypervisor used for virtualization, a Virtualization Engineer designs and manages virtual environments across various platforms, including Xen, VMware, and Hyper-V. The roles overlap in certifications and work environments, but Virtualization Engineers have broader responsibilities across multiple virtualization technologies.
